BAFF, APRIL and pathogenic immunoglobulin
Atacicept is a soluble TACI-based fusion protein that binds BAFF and APRIL, survival signals involved in B-cell and antibody biology. In IgA nephropathy, reducing pathogenic galactose-deficient IgA1 is intended to interrupt an upstream driver of immune-complex injury. Analytical judgment: this differs from simply changing glomerular hemodynamics, but mechanisms can converge on the same proteinuria endpoint. A fall in IgA-related biomarkers strengthens evidence of target action without directly proving preserved nephron function. The full causal chain should show immunologic change, proteinuria improvement and a credible eGFR trajectory. Background renin–angiotensin blockade and SGLT2 inhibitors affect both proteinuria and filtration and must remain visible when comparing studies conducted in different treatment eras. [2] [5]
Randomized Phase 2b versus extension
ORIGIN Phase 2b randomized 116 participants across weekly 25, 75 or 150 mg atacicept and placebo. The prespecified pooled 75/150 mg comparison showed 25% relative proteinuria reduction versus placebo at week 24 and 35% at week 36. The week-36 eGFR comparison favored active treatment by approximately 5.7 mL/min/1.73m². The extension exposed 113 participants to atacicept, with 102 completing extension treatment. Analytical judgment: randomized eGFR support is useful but a small short-duration comparison is vulnerable to baseline variation. Later open-label stabilization is supportive durability evidence, not a continued placebo-controlled estimate, because previous placebo recipients crossed to drug and continuing participants were selected survivors. Extension and blinded-period denominators must not be interchanged. [2] [3]
ORIGIN 3 interim clinical evidence
The FDA review identifies the first 203 randomized and dosed participants in the interim set: 106 assigned atacicept and 97 placebo. Reported week-36 proteinuria reductions were 46% and 7%, with a model-based 42% relative reduction versus placebo, p<0.0001. The relative effect is not obtained by subtracting forty-six and seven percentage points. Analytical judgment: a ratio-based analysis of a skewed biomarker asks a different statistical question from an arithmetic difference in raw urine values. The full randomized population and the interim subset should be distinguished, as should model contributors and everyone dosed. Strong proteinuria separation raises the plausibility of kidney benefit but leaves open its magnitude, duration and sensitivity to missing eGFR measurements. [1] [4] [6]

Earlier eGFR analysis and estimands
Vera announced FDA alignment in June 2026 to bring the ORIGIN 3 eGFR analysis forward to the third quarter of 2026, with a possible subsequent supplemental application. The company's announcement does not disclose every revised statistical detail. Analytical judgment: evaluate the prespecified total and chronic eGFR slopes, follow-up distribution, acute changes, confidence intervals and handling of rescue or discontinued treatment. An early hemodynamic shift can alter a total slope without implying sustained structural benefit, while a chronic slope omitting early observations answers a narrower question. The assessment should also report how much information comes from participants with longer follow-up. A regulatory agreement to analyze sooner is not advance confirmation that the effect will be positive or sufficient for full approval. [4] [5]
Immunoglobulin suppression and durability
BAFF/APRIL inhibition requires attention to immunoglobulin concentrations and infection alongside injection tolerability. The Phase 2 publication described a safety profile similar to placebo, while extension observations add exposure without a persistent untreated comparison. Analytical judgment: a reduction in pathogenic antibody can coexist with a reduction in protective immunity, so aggregate adverse-event similarity should be supplemented by serious infection, low-IgG thresholds, treatment interruption and discontinuation. Kidney disease also changes baseline infection vulnerability. A favorable confirmatory result would combine slower eGFR loss with persistent proteinuria benefit and a manageable immune-safety burden. If eGFR is weak despite substantial proteinuria suppression, the discrepancy should be investigated using exposure, follow-up and missing-data analyses rather than dismissed as a statistical inconvenience. September 15: final kidney-function results
Vera reported the previously expected Q3 final ORIGIN 3 analysis on September 15. This clinical readout moves to History, separate from the July accelerated approval. The final analysis set is 428; the announcement does not allocate that set by arm or provide visit-specific analyzed N. It reports all prespecified endpoints met and plans a Q4 supplemental BLA. A plan to file is neither an accepted application nor full approval. [7]

What the final analysis adds, and what remains open
The prior proteinuria result remains preserved above. The new filtration and progression evidence addresses a more direct clinical question, but each endpoint has its own time scale: a week-52 change is not an annual slope through week 104. A 76% relative hazard reduction is not a 76-percentage-point absolute risk reduction. The small severe-outcome count is supportive and cannot independently establish a mortality benefit. [7]
The release identifies hierarchical testing for proteinuria, Gd-IgA1 and hematuria, but does not reproduce the revised full testing sequence, estimand, missing-data handling or exact composite definition. Those should be checked in the final presentation and analysis plan before treating every component as independently confirmed. No equal arm allocation is assumed from the aggregate final N.
Final-analysis safety is not the older label dataset
The announcement describes similar overall adverse-event and infection rates and reports no opportunistic infections or clinically relevant hypogammaglobulinemia. It does not supply final-analysis group totals for TEAE, SAE, deaths or adverse-event discontinuations. The 32% versus 28% infection figures in its prescribing-information section belong to the labeled dataset, not an explicitly identified week-104 safety analysis; they are not substituted into the new results table.
